You have to be level 2 to do the "red cent" thing and it looks like you are level 2 now. So go give some Red Cents! Make some posts and earn them!

So as said above level 2 can give other posts a red cent up to 4 in 24 hours. When you give one it will earn you 1 red cent and the post you put it on will earn that person 10 red cents. So you can see both parties win. But you earn more by being the person who posted something informative, funny or of interest. Either way, giving or receiving, you can easily earn enough to keep your level 2 each month.
